In the world of politics, opposition movements play a crucial role in holding the government accountable and advocating for change. However, building a successful opposition coalition can be a challenging task that requires strategic planning and coordination. In this blog post, we will explore some effective strategies for building opposition coalitions that can effectively challenge the government and advance their goals.
1. Identify Common Goals and Values: One of the first steps in building an opposition coalition is to identify common goals and values that unite different groups and individuals. By focusing on shared objectives, such as promoting democracy, protecting human rights, or advancing social justice, opposition movements can create a strong sense of solidarity and purpose.
2. Reach Out to Diverse Groups: Building a broad-based opposition coalition requires reaching out to a diverse range of groups and individuals who may have different backgrounds, interests, and priorities. By engaging with labor unions, civil society organizations, student groups, and other stakeholders, opposition movements can amplify their message and mobilize a larger base of supporters.
3. Foster Trust and Collaboration: Trust is essential for building strong opposition coalitions, as it allows different groups to work together effectively and overcome internal divisions. By fostering open communication, transparency, and mutual respect, opposition movements can build trust among coalition members and facilitate collaboration on common objectives.
4. Develop a Clear Strategy and Action Plan: Successful opposition movements have a clear strategy and action plan that outlines their goals, tactics, and timelines for achieving change. By developing a well-defined strategy, opposition coalitions can focus their efforts, coordinate their actions, and maximize their impact on the government.
5. Utilize Strategic Communication: Effective communication is key to building public support for an opposition coalition and putting pressure on the government. By utilizing social media, traditional media, public events, and other communication channels, opposition movements can raise awareness about their issues, mobilize supporters, and challenge government narratives.
6. Build Resilience and Adaptability: Opposition movements often face challenges, setbacks, and repression from the government. Building resilience and adaptability is essential for overcoming obstacles and continuing to advocate for change. By learning from past experiences, adjusting their strategies, and persevering in the face of adversity, opposition coalitions can sustain their momentum and effect lasting change.
In conclusion, building a successful opposition coalition requires strategic planning, collaboration, and resilience. By identifying common goals, reaching out to diverse groups, fostering trust, developing a clear strategy, utilizing strategic communication, and building resilience, opposition movements can effectively challenge the government and advance their objectives.
